📋Overview
MSM (methylsulfonylmethane) is an organosulfur compound that occurs naturally in humans, animals, and many plants. This substance is also synthesized in laboratory environments to create standardized forms for commercial availability.
As a source of organic sulfur, this ingredient is a component of various biological structures. It is commonly found in the form of a white, crystalline solid and is utilized in a variety of dietary products.
